EUDP ready with new funds in 2022

In 2022, it will also be possible to apply for funding for the development, demonstration and testing of energy technology solutions through the national support programs EUDP (The Energy Technology Development and Demonstration Program) and Green Labs DK. The board of the programs has just opened for applicants for the next round, which has a deadline for project applicants on March 4, 2022, writes EUDP in a press release.

- We know that new climate technologies will deliver a significant part of the CO2 reduction of 70 percent that we in Denmark must achieve by 2030. Therefore, we hope to see a large number of innovative applications in 2022, so that we extend the interest in green innovation that we saw in 2021, when the interest in applying for EUDP support was historically high, says Anne Grete Holmsgaard, chairman of the board of EUDP.

EUDP's award pool is DKK 200 million. kr next year. The Green Labs DK pool is 17.5 million. kr and is targeted at establishing facilities where companies can demonstrate and test new climate technologies under realistic circumstances. In addition, the North Sea pool of 4.9 million. kr is also open, which supports development and demonstration projects with associated research that can contribute to a more environmentally friendly and energy-efficient production of oil and gas. In 2021, two application rounds for EUDP applied for a total of 2.1 billion. kr.
